Understanding the Cabin Air Filter and Its Vital Role
The cabin air filter, sometimes referred to as the interior air filter or micro-filter, is a component designed to clean the air that enters the passenger compartment through the heating, ventilation, and air conditioning (HVAC) system. In the 2018 Chevy Cruze, as in most modern vehicles, this filter is the first line of defense against external pollutants. Its primary function is to trap and hold particulate matter before the air is circulated inside the car. This includes dust, pollen, smog, soot, mold spores, and other airborne contaminants. A secondary, crucial function of many modern cabin filters, including those often specified for the 2018 Cruze, is odor reduction. Activated carbon-impregnated filters adsorb gaseous pollutants and unpleasant odors, such as those from exhaust fumes, industrial emissions, and general environmental smells. The presence of a clean, functioning filter ensures that the air you and your passengers breathe is significantly cleaner, which is particularly important for individuals with allergies, asthma, or other respiratory sensitivities. Furthermore, it protects the interior HVAC components, such as the blower motor, evaporator core, and ductwork, from a buildup of debris that can restrict airflow, reduce system efficiency, lead to unpleasant musty odors, and potentially cause costly repairs.
Specifics for the 2018 Chevrolet Cruze: Location, Types, and Part Information
The cabin air filter in the 2018 Chevrolet Cruze is located behind the glove compartment. This is a standard placement for General Motors vehicles of this era, designed for relative ease of access without requiring specialized tools. The vehicle is engineered to use a specific size and shape of filter cartridge. For the 2018 model year, the Cruze typically uses a rectangular, pleated-panel style filter. There are two main material types available on the aftermarket: particulate filters and combination (activated carbon) filters. The standard particulate filter is effective at trapping solid particles like dust and pollen. The activated carbon filter provides the same particulate filtration with the added layer of chemical absorption for gases and odors. Consulting your 2018 Cruze owner's manual will confirm the exact part number or specifications. Common aftermarket part numbers that correspond to the correct fit include frameworks like CF10134 (a common ACDelco or equivalent number), but it is always best to verify compatibility by your vehicle's VIN or through a reliable parts lookup tool. The physical dimensions and the design of the filter housing are precise; using an incorrectly sized or shaped filter can lead to gaps that allow unfiltered air to bypass the media, rendering it ineffective, or cause difficulty in reinstalling the glove compartment assembly.
Recognizing the Signs That Your 2018 Cruze’s Cabin Filter Needs Replacement
A failing or clogged cabin air filter manifests through several noticeable symptoms in your vehicle's operation and interior environment. Being aware of these signs allows for proactive replacement before issues compound. The most common indicator is a significant reduction in airflow from the HVAC vents. When you turn the fan to its highest speed, you may notice that the air volume feels weaker than it used to, regardless of the temperature setting. This occurs as the clogged filter physically restricts the passage of air into the blower fan. Another clear sign is persistent, unusual odors entering the cabin when the HVAC system is active. A musty, moldy smell often indicates that moisture and organic debris have accumulated on a dirty filter, promoting microbial growth. Conversely, an increase in outside exhaust or foul smells entering the cabin suggests the filter's adsorbent layer (if equipped) is saturated and no longer effective. Increased noise from the blower motor, such as straining or whistling sounds, can also point to excessive restriction caused by a dirty filter forcing the motor to work harder. For occupants with allergies, a noticeable increase in sneezing, watery eyes, or general respiratory irritation during drives is a strong practical signal that the filter is no longer capturing allergens effectively. General dust accumulation on the dashboard and interior surfaces faster than usual can also be a clue. Manufacturers typically recommend a replacement interval, often between 15,000 and 25,000 miles or once a year, but driving in conditions with high pollen levels, constant stop-and-go traffic, or on dusty rural roads necessitates more frequent checks and changes.

Step-by-Step Guide to Replacing the Cabin Air Filter in a 2018 Chevy Cruze
This procedure is designed for the typical 2018 Cruze sedan. The process for the hatchback model is virtually identical. Always refer to your official owner's manual for the most vehicle-specific instructions.
- Empty and Access the Glove Compartment: Open the glove compartment door and remove all contents. Inspect the interior sides and top of the glove compartment bin. You are looking for stops or dampers that control its range of motion.
- Lower the Glove Compartment: On most 2018 Cruze models, the glove compartment is allowed to swing down further than its normal open position to reveal the filter housing behind it. To do this, you may need to press inward on the sides of the glove compartment bin to clear the plastic stops that hold it in place, or gently squeeze the sides together. Some variants have a simple damper arm on the right side that must be unclipped. Allow the glove box to hang down freely toward the floor of the passenger footwell.
- Locate and Open the Filter Housing: Shine your flashlight behind where the glove box was. You will see a rectangular, thin plastic cover, usually about 8 inches by 10 inches, with a series of plastic tabs or clips along its sides. This is the access door to the filter housing. The tabs are typically designed to be released by pressing them inward toward the center of the cover or pulling them outward. Carefully release all retaining tabs. The cover should then come free. Set it aside.
- Remove the Old Filter: With the cover removed, you will see the edge of the old cabin air filter. Note the direction of the airflow arrows printed on the frame of the old filter. This is crucial. Grip the filter and slide it straight out of the housing. Be prepared for some loose debris to fall; you may wish to have a small vacuum or rag handy to clean the now-empty filter slot in the housing.
- Clean the Housing (Recommended): Before inserting the new filter, take a moment to inspect the empty housing. Use a vacuum cleaner with a crevice tool to gently remove any leaves, twigs, or accumulated dust from the cavity. Wipe around the edges with a damp cloth if necessary. Ensure the area is dry before proceeding.
- Install the New Filter: Take your new filter and observe the airflow arrows molded or printed on its plastic frame. The arrows must point in the correct direction, which is almost always pointing toward the interior of the car (away from the front firewall) or downward, depending on housing design. For the 2018 Cruze, the standard direction is for the arrows to point toward the floor of the vehicle or in the direction of airflow into the blower fan. If in doubt, the arrows on the old filter are your definitive guide. Carefully slide the new filter into the housing, ensuring it sits flush and seats completely in the tracks. Do not force it.
- Reattach the Cover and Glove Box: Retrieve the plastic access cover. Align it correctly with the housing and press firmly until all the retaining tabs click securely into place. Finally, lift the glove compartment back up into its normal position. You may need to guide the damper arm back into its socket or align the sides of the bin with the stops on the dashboard. Press firmly until the glove box latches shut securely.
- Final Check: Open and close the glove compartment normally a few times to ensure it operates smoothly and latches properly. There should be no obstructions or unusual resistance.
Post-Replacement Verification and System Testing
After successful installation, conduct a simple test to confirm the system is working correctly. Start the vehicle's engine. Turn the HVAC fan to its highest speed. Set the system to fresh air intake mode (not recirculation) to draw air through the new filter. You should immediately notice a difference. The airflow from the vents should be stronger and more robust compared to before the replacement. There should be no musty or dusty odor; the air should smell clean and neutral. Listen to the blower motor; any previous straining or whistling noises caused by restriction should be eliminated or significantly reduced. Allow the system to run for a few minutes on both cool and warm settings to ensure proper operation across the HVAC functions. This simple test verifies that the filter is installed correctly, without any blockage or incorrect orientation that could impede airflow.
Developing a Proactive Maintenance Schedule
Do not wait for symptoms to appear before replacing your cabin air filter. Adopting a proactive schedule is the best practice. The general recommendation in the 2018 Cruze owner's manual is a good starting point, but tailor it to your driving conditions. A standard guideline is to inspect the filter every 15,000 miles or once per year, whichever comes first, and replace it as needed. For severe service conditions—which include frequent driving on dirt or gravel roads, consistent operation in heavy stop-and-go traffic where exhaust fumes are prevalent, or residing in areas with high seasonal pollen or pollution counts—the inspection and replacement interval should be halved, to every 7,500 to 10,000 miles or every six months. A good habit is to schedule the cabin air filter check alongside every other engine oil change. This makes it easy to remember and ensures regular attention. Seasonal changes are also an opportune time; replacing the filter in the spring before peak pollen season and in the fall before the heating season begins can dramatically improve your in-car experience year-round.
Common DIY Mistakes and How to Avoid Them
Even in a simple task, errors can occur. Being aware of them prevents frustration and ensures the job is done right. The most frequent mistake is installing the new filter with the airflow arrows pointing in the wrong direction. This forces the HVAC system to pull air through the filter backwards, which can reduce efficiency, compromise the filter media, and potentially damage the pleats. Always double-check the arrow direction against the old filter or housing markings. Another error is forcing the filter into place. If it does not slide in smoothly, do not apply excessive pressure. Remove it, verify you have the correct part number and that it is aligned properly with the housing tracks. Forcing it can bend the frame, damage the sealing edges, and create gaps for unfiltered air. Failing to properly secure the plastic access cover is also common. Ensure all tabs are fully engaged and the cover is flush. A loose cover can rattle and, more importantly, allow unfiltered air to bypass the filter entirely. Finally, neglecting to clean the filter housing before inserting the new filter is a missed opportunity. Any debris left in the housing can be sucked into the blower fan immediately or soil the new filter prematurely.
When to Consider Professional Service
While this is a highly accessible DIY job, there are circumstances where seeking professional service is prudent. If, during the inspection process, you encounter significant corrosion, damage, or broken clips on the filter housing or glove compartment assembly, a professional technician can properly assess and repair it. If you are uncomfortable performing any mechanical task or lack the minimal tools, a quick visit to a trusted local mechanic, dealership service center, or even a quick-lube shop is a low-cost alternative. The labor time for this job is minimal, so the total cost should be reasonable, consisting mostly of the part and a small service fee. Furthermore, if you perform the replacement and the symptoms of poor airflow or odors persist, a professional diagnosis is warranted, as the issue may lie elsewhere in the HVAC system, such as a blocked intake vent under the windshield cowl, a failing blower motor resistor, or mold growth on the evaporator core.

Related Components and System Synergy
While focusing on the cabin air filter, it is useful to understand its role within the broader vehicle systems. The cabin air filter works in conjunction with the HVAC system's mode controls, such as the recirculation/fresh air vent. Using recirculation mode reduces the load on the cabin filter by recycling already-filtered interior air, which is beneficial in heavy traffic or when passing through areas with intense odors. However, it should not be used exclusively, as it can lead to window fogging and stale air. The cabin filter is entirely separate from the engine air filter, which cleans air entering the engine for combustion. Both are vital but serve completely different purposes; both require regular replacement per their own schedules. A clean cabin air filter also supports the efficient operation of the air conditioning system. A clogged filter restricts airflow over the evaporator coil, which can reduce the system's cooling capacity and potentially lead to freeze-ups or other operational issues. Maintaining a fresh filter thus contributes to overall passenger comfort and HVAC system longevity.
